Campoamor insights

AspectSummary
Gross YieldTypically ranges from 5% to 8% depending on location and property type.
Rental DemandHigh demand due to tourism and expat communities.
Average Rent PriceApproximately €800 to €1,200 per month for short-term rentals.
Vacancy RatesGenerally low, around 5% to 10%.
Tenant Turnover RateModerate, around 30% annually for long-term rentals.
Operating ExpensesRanging from 20% to 30% of rental income, including property management.
Regulation and Rent ControlModerate regulations; limited rent control for long-term leases.
Furnishing/Unfurnishing Rate75% of rentals are furnished, attracting more tenants.
Short-Term vs. Long-Term Rental MixApproximately 60% short-term, 40% long-term.
Local Economic IndicatorsStrong tourism sector supports rental market.
Rental Price TrendsPrices increased steadily; slight stabilization observed recently.
Lease TermsStandard leases last 12 months for long-term rentals.
Deposit RequirementsTypically one to two months' rent as a deposit.
Utilities and Other CostsUtilities average €100 to €150 per month, dependent on size.
Safety and SecurityGenerally safe, low crime rates in residential areas.

Campoamor FAQ

  • What is the average rent price for a one-bedroom apartment in Campoamor?

    The average rent price for a one-bedroom apartment in Campoamor typically ranges from €500 to €700 per month, depending on various factors such as location, amenities, and proximity to the beach. For instance, a modern apartment near the coast might cost around €650, while a slightly older unit further inland could be available for around €500. Seasonal fluctuations can also affect pricing, with summer months often seeing a spike due to increased demand from tourists. Additionally, utilities and community fees may not be included in the rent, which can add another €100 to €150 to the monthly expense.

  • How much does it typically cost to rent a villa in Campoamor?

    The cost of renting a villa in Campoamor can vary significantly based on factors such as location, amenities, and the time of year. Typically, during the peak summer months, prices for a three-bedroom villa can range from €1,000 to €2,500 per week, with properties closer to the beach or with a private pool generally commanding higher rates. For instance, a modern villa in a gated community might charge around €1,800 for a week in July, while a more basic accommodation could go for about €1,200. Off-season rentals in the fall or spring may see prices drop to between €600 and €1,200 per week, making it a more budget-friendly option for visitors. Moreover, some luxury villas with extensive gardens, high-end furnishings, and proximity to golf courses can exceed €3,000 per week during the high season. Additional costs like cleaning fees or security deposits may also apply.

  • Are rental prices in Campoamor higher during the summer months?

    Rental prices in Campoamor typically see a noticeable increase during the summer months, driven largely by the influx of tourists seeking the coastal charm of this Spanish destination. For instance, a two-bedroom apartment that may rent for around €600 per month in the off-season could rise to €1,200 or more during peak vacation periods. Beachfront properties, which are particularly desirable, often experience even steeper price hikes. A villa with ocean views might command rates that double or triple, reflecting high demand. Additionally, the availability of amenities such as pools and proximity to beaches further impacts pricing, with many landlords capitalizing on the seasonal surge in travelers looking for temporary accommodation. The vibrant summer atmosphere in Campoamor, featuring local festivals and events, also attracts visitors, allowing property owners to maximize their rental income during these warm months.

  • Is it cheaper to rent a long-term property or a holiday rental in Campoamor?

    In Campoamor, the cost of renting a long-term property often proves to be more economical compared to holiday rentals, particularly during peak tourist seasons. Long-term rentals typically range from €600 to €1,200 per month for a two-bedroom apartment, depending on the location and amenities. In contrast, a week-long stay in a holiday rental can cost anywhere from €500 to €1,500, especially in summer months when demand surges. Additionally, holiday rentals frequently charge extra for utilities or cleaning fees, which can add up significantly. For example, a beachfront holiday rental might seem affordable at first glance but could end up costing €2,000 for just two weeks when all fees are included. Seasonal fluctuations in pricing can further impact costs, making long-term leases a more stable option for those looking to stay in Campoamor.

  • How do rental prices in Campoamor compare to nearby areas?

    Rental prices in Campoamor tend to be more competitive compared to nearby areas like Torrevieja and La Zenia. In Campoamor, one-bedroom apartments typically range from €500 to €800 per month, whereas in Torrevieja, similar accommodations can be found for around €450 to €700. On the other hand, La Zenia, known for its proximity to the beach, often sees prices that edge higher, with one-bedroom rentals averaging between €600 and €900. Additionally, while Campoamor offers a mix of both residential and holiday rentals, areas like Torrevieja may have a larger selection of lower-priced options due to its larger size and diverse population. The difference in prices can also reflect the amenities and seasonal demand, especially considering Campoamor’s appeal during the summer months.
